Highlights at a glance
Polyvinyl chloride (PVC) is a high-density synthetic polymer renowned for its exceptional hardness, impact resistance, and durability, making it indispensable across industrial and consumer applications. These properties arise from its molecular structure—rich in chlorine atoms—which enhances intermolecular forces, promotes tight chain packing, and increases rigidity. In piping systems, high-density PVC outperforms traditional materials like cast iron and cement by offering superior corrosion resistance, lighter weight, longer service life (exceeding 50 years), and resilience against mechanical stress and chemical exposure. It is widely used in municipal water and drainage infrastructure as well as industrial fluid transport. In construction, PVC’s durability makes it ideal for window frames, where it resists deformation, UV degradation, and weathering while providing excellent thermal insulation and sealing performance—outlasting wood and aluminum alternatives. Its long lifespan, low maintenance, and structural stability have made it a preferred choice in modern architecture. Beyond these core uses, high-density PVC also serves automotive sectors, being employed in interior components and protective panels due to its ability to withstand impact and maintain shape under stress. These versatile attributes underscore PVC's critical role in sustainable, cost-effective engineering solutions.
